如何保存服务器数据库
- 2025-03-17 10:00:00
- admin 原创
- 86
服务器数据库保存的重要性
服务器数据库犹如企业的核心宝藏,承载着大量关键信息。从客户资料、交易记录到业务流程数据,这些信息是企业运营和决策的基石。保存服务器数据库,首先是为了防止数据丢失。硬件故障、软件错误、人为误操作甚至自然灾害,都可能导致数据瞬间消失。一旦数据丢失,企业可能面临客户资源流失、业务流程混乱等严重后果。其次,准确完整的数据库保存有助于企业进行数据分析和挖掘。通过对历史数据的分析,企业能洞察市场趋势、客户需求,从而制定更精准的战略决策,提升竞争力。再者,在合规性方面,许多行业法规和政策要求企业妥善保存数据,以确保数据的安全性和可追溯性,保存服务器数据库是企业满足合规要求的必要举措。
数据保存能保障企业业务的连续性。想象一下,若电商企业的订单数据库丢失,将无法准确处理订单、跟踪物流,客户满意度会急剧下降,企业声誉受损。而完整保存数据库,即使遇到突发状况,也能快速恢复业务,将损失降到最低。同时,对于企业的长期发展,积累的历史数据是宝贵财富。通过对多年销售数据的分析,能发现产品的生命周期规律,提前布局新产品研发和市场推广,为企业的可持续发展提供有力支撑。
常见的服务器数据库保存方法
定期备份
定期备份是最基础且常用的方法。通过设置特定的时间间隔,如每天、每周或每月,将数据库中的数据复制到外部存储设备或远程服务器。备份过程相对简单,许多数据库管理系统都自带备份功能。以常见的 MySQL 数据库为例,可使用 mysqldump 命令行工具进行备份。在备份时,要确保备份文件的存储位置安全,防止因本地灾害导致备份数据一同丢失。同时,定期检查备份文件的完整性,确保在需要时能成功恢复。
定期备份能有效应对日常的数据变化和潜在风险。比如,若服务器在某天出现故障,可利用前一天的备份数据进行恢复,将数据损失控制在一天内。而且,这种方法对系统资源的占用相对较小,不会过多影响服务器的正常运行。不过,定期备份也有局限性,若在两次备份之间发生数据丢失或损坏,这段时间内的数据将无法恢复。
实时复制
实时复制是一种更为高级的保存方式。它通过技术手段使主服务器和从服务器之间保持数据的实时同步。当主服务器上的数据发生变化时,这些变化会立即被复制到从服务器上。这种方式能极大地提高数据的可用性和容错性。以 Oracle 数据库的 Data Guard 功能为例,它能实现主备数据库之间的实时同步。在主服务器出现故障时,从服务器可迅速切换为主服务器,确保业务不受影响。
实时复制适合对数据及时性要求极高的企业,如金融机构。在股票交易系统中,数据的实时性关乎交易的准确性和安全性。通过实时复制,能保证各个交易节点的数据一致,避免因数据差异导致的交易风险。但实时复制对网络带宽和服务器性能有较高要求,实施成本相对较高。
云存储备份
随着云计算技术的发展,云存储备份成为越来越多企业的选择。企业将服务器数据库备份上传到云端存储,借助云服务提供商的强大基础设施和专业管理能力,确保数据的安全保存。像 Amazon S3、阿里云 OSS 等云存储服务,提供了高可靠性和可扩展性的存储方案。云存储备份具有便捷性,企业无需担心本地存储设备的容量限制和维护问题。
云存储备份还具备强大的灾难恢复能力。即使企业本地数据中心遭受严重灾害,也能从云端快速恢复数据。同时,云服务提供商通常会采用多重数据冗余和加密技术,保障数据的安全性。然而,使用云存储备份也存在数据传输延迟、网络依赖等问题,企业在选择时需综合考虑自身需求和网络状况。
保存服务器数据库的注意事项
数据验证与完整性检查
在保存服务器数据库过程中,数据验证和完整性检查至关重要。首先要确保备份数据的准确性,通过与原始数据进行比对,检查是否存在数据丢失或错误。例如,在备份完成后,可使用数据库自带的验证工具对备份文件进行校验。对于关键数据字段,要进行完整性检查,保证数据的逻辑一致性。比如,在订单数据库中,订单金额与商品数量、单价之间的计算关系应正确无误。
定期进行数据验证和完整性检查能及时发现潜在问题。若在备份数据中发现错误,可及时追溯到原始数据进行修正,避免错误数据的积累。同时,这有助于提高数据的质量,为后续的数据分析和使用提供可靠基础。企业应制定严格的数据验证和完整性检查流程,并安排专人负责,确保工作的落实。
存储介质与环境
选择合适的存储介质和良好的存储环境对保存服务器数据库至关重要。对于本地备份,可选用磁带、磁盘阵列等存储介质。磁带具有大容量、低成本的优势,适合长期数据存储;磁盘阵列则读写速度快,便于快速恢复数据。在存储环境方面,要保持适宜的温度、湿度,避免灰尘、磁场等干扰。数据中心应配备完善的空调、除湿设备,确保存储设备处于稳定的运行环境。
存储介质的质量和寿命直接影响数据的保存期限。劣质存储介质可能出现数据丢失或损坏的情况。因此,要选择知名品牌、质量可靠的存储设备,并定期对存储介质进行检查和维护。同时,合理规划存储环境,能延长存储设备的使用寿命,降低数据丢失风险。
安全防护
服务器数据库保存涉及大量敏感信息,安全防护必不可少。要对备份数据进行加密处理,防止数据在传输和存储过程中被窃取或篡改。采用先进的加密算法,如 AES 加密,对备份文件进行加密。同时,设置严格的访问权限,只有经过授权的人员才能访问备份数据。在网络安全方面,要防止黑客攻击和恶意软件入侵,安装防火墙、入侵检测系统等安全防护软件。
安全防护是一个持续的过程,企业要不断关注网络安全动态,及时更新安全防护措施。定期进行安全漏洞扫描,发现问题及时修复。此外,对员工进行安全意识培训,提高员工对数据安全的重视程度,避免因人为疏忽导致安全事故。
总结
服务器数据库保存是企业运营中不可忽视的重要环节。它不仅关乎数据的安全性和完整性,更影响着企业的业务连续性和发展战略。通过定期备份、实时复制、云存储备份等多种方法,企业能根据自身需求选择合适的保存方式。在实施过程中,要注意数据验证与完整性检查、存储介质与环境以及安全防护等方面。
数据验证与完整性检查能确保保存的数据准确可用,为企业决策提供可靠依据;合适的存储介质和良好的存储环境是数据长期保存的基础;强大的安全防护则能防止数据泄露和恶意破坏。企业应建立完善的服务器数据库保存体系,将这些措施有机结合起来。
同时,要随着技术的发展和企业业务的变化,不断优化和调整保存策略。只有这样,企业才能在复杂多变的环境中,有效保存服务器数据库,充分发挥数据的价值,实现可持续发展。
FAQ 常见问题解答
备份数据的频率应该如何确定?
备份数据的频率需综合多方面因素确定。如果数据变化频繁且重要,如电商平台的交易数据,建议每天甚至更短时间进行备份;对于数据变化相对缓慢的企业,如一些传统制造业的基础资料数据,每周或每月备份可能就足够。同时,还要考虑恢复数据的成本和可接受的数据丢失时长。若企业能承受一天的数据丢失,那么每天备份一次基本能满足需求;若对数据实时性要求极高,实时复制或更频繁的备份方式则更为合适。
云存储备份的安全性如何保障?
云存储备份的安全性主要通过多种技术和管理措施保障。云服务提供商通常采用数据加密技术,在数据传输和存储过程中进行加密,防止数据被窃取。同时,会采用多重数据冗余存储,确保数据在部分存储节点出现故障时仍可恢复。在管理方面,云服务提供商有严格的访问控制机制,只有经过授权的人员才能访问数据。此外,云服务提供商还会定期进行安全审计和漏洞扫描,及时发现和修复安全问题。企业自身也可对上传到云存储的备份数据进行二次加密,进一步增强安全性。
如何确保备份数据能够成功恢复?
要确保备份数据能够成功恢复,首先要定期进行恢复测试。按照预定的恢复流程,使用备份数据进行恢复操作,检查恢复后的数据是否完整、可用。在备份过程中,要详细记录备份的相关信息,如备份时间、备份版本、备份数据的范围等,以便在恢复时能准确选择合适的备份文件。同时,要保证恢复环境与原始生产环境尽量一致,包括操作系统、数据库版本、服务器配置等。此外,对负责恢复操作的人员进行专业培训,使其熟悉恢复流程和可能遇到的问题及解决方法,提高恢复成功的概率 。
扫码咨询,免费领取项目管理大礼包!